How Robot Hoovers Can Improve Your Home

robotic-vacuum-cleaner-cleaning-the-room-while-wom-2024-11-07-13-20-10-utc-min-jpg-original.jpgMany robots have the ability to map, which allows them to remember how your home is laid out. This can help them avoid hitting into furniture or other obstacles, and also helps in cleaning more thoroughly.

robot-vacuum-mops-logo-text-black-png-original.jpgChoose a robot with a long battery life and big dust bin. Look for models that recharge and then resume where they left off. This is particularly helpful for larger homes.

Think about the type of floor you have and cleaning needs when selecting a robot vacuum or mop. Some models offer specific settings for each type, and some have smart sensors that can determine the most suitable settings for your home's floors. For example, carpets need more suction power than hardwood floors. A robotic vacuum that can recognize this will adjust its suction power accordingly.

A second consideration is the size and shape of your house and furniture. You'll need a robot vacuum that can navigate through obstacles and fit into tight spaces. Find an option that gives you a clear overview of its path in the app, and the ability to set room-specific cleaning and digital keep out zones.
